      I have a question about port forwarding.
      My setup is as follows.

      www–--(202.101.224.69)PFSENSE BOX(192.168.1.1)-----Switch/LAN----webserver(192.168.1.2)
                                                                |
                                                                |------client 192.168.1.3

      I port forward 202.101.224.69 port 80 to 192.168.1.2 port 80 ,webserver can be access from outside.
      but client can't access webserver by ip 202.101.224.69 ,it is display time out.client can access webserver by ip 192.168.1.2.
      someone advise me add rule like this
      rdr on rl0 inet proto tcp from 192.168.1.0/24 to 220.101.224.69 port 80 -> 192.168.1.2 port 80 (rl0 is Lan interface)
      but i can't setup this by pfsense WebGui!
      Can anyone give me some advice?

        At system>advanced enable nat reflection (very bottom of the page).
